The 96 Well form is a critical document utilized in various contexts, particularly in laboratory and research settings. This form is designed to streamline the process of collecting and organizing data from experiments conducted in 96-well plates, which are commonly used in biological and chemical research. Researchers benefit from the structured layout that allows for clear documentation of sample information, including identifiers, concentrations, and experimental conditions. The form typically includes sections for recording the type of assay being performed, the reagents used, and any observations made during the experiment. Accurate completion of the 96 Well form is essential for ensuring reproducibility and reliability of results, which are fundamental principles in scientific research. By providing a comprehensive overview of the experimental setup, this form aids in data analysis and facilitates collaboration among team members. In addition, the use of a standardized format helps in maintaining consistency across different studies, making it easier to compare results and draw conclusions.

  1. What is the purpose of the 96 Well form?

    The 96 Well form is designed to facilitate the organization and tracking of samples in a laboratory setting. It is commonly used in various scientific fields, including biology, chemistry, and medical research. Each well in the form can hold a different sample, allowing researchers to conduct multiple tests simultaneously and efficiently.

  2. How do I fill out the 96 Well form correctly?

    Filling out the 96 Well form requires attention to detail. Start by labeling each well according to the sample it will contain. Use clear and concise identifiers, such as sample numbers or names. Additionally, ensure that any relevant information, such as date, experiment type, and researcher initials, is included in the designated sections of the form. This practice helps maintain accurate records and prevents confusion during analysis.

  3. Can I use the 96 Well form for different types of experiments?

    Yes, the 96 Well form is versatile and can be adapted for various types of experiments. Whether you are conducting PCR, enzyme assays, or cell culture experiments, this form can be utilized to organize your samples effectively. It is essential, however, to modify the labeling and information to suit the specific requirements of each experiment.
